Houston based band Buxton's music is a study in contrasts: rock and folk, subtle yet eccentric, lush harmonies over prickly guitar. Paste explains, "The sound on Nothing Here Seems Strange fluctuates between traditional Americana and a more garagefolk sound that places the album in a larger scope than you'd expect of a folk band." They rock with a fusion of lovely harmonies, jarring explosions of energy and meticulously applied instrumentation that is at once totally unexpected and completely welcome. Buxton recently released their debut album, Nothing Here Seems Strange, which has been a critical success.
